Output 31fa00cb07e104cc31ddba76787cd972eab676314eeaec58d8a0c1e2c247b96b:0

value
43865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f2f7ed00fad001858ea7707fe05527778b2fbf1 OP_EQUAL
address
3DHWdwac4bXWYrUaAiJNFHjo9TtQ4tnYHQ
transaction
31fa00cb07e104cc31ddba76787cd972eab676314eeaec58d8a0c1e2c247b96b
confirmations
334351
spent
true